QUT Design Intensive
As part of QUT's impact lab 2: People Design Intensive, we were given the privilege to work on a brief given to us by the non-for-profit organisation Multicap. Multicap has a program called Makeables, which provides jobs for people with disabilities. These people working for makable were our clients during this project as we designed a solution to improve their lives in some aspect. Our solution was The Ink Project which is a new creative service in Makeables' workshops that does screen-printing. It provides extra value and credibility to the clients. Screen-printing is not only something that the clients would enjoy doing, but it is a form of advertising as their products are available to customers. Because screen printing is a known hand made product, customers will ask who made it and that will lead back to Makeables, giving them satisfaction and more meaning to their work, which was our main goal.
